"The normal thing" is to restore the whole table (DBF, FPT and CDX). Restoring only FPT can leave the table in corrupted state.

Depending on a type of corruption, you can scan through the table and copy records out one by one using SCATTER/GATHER wrapped in TRY...ENDTRY.


>WE have all seen "FPT is missing or is invalid" and the normal thing is just copy a backup FPT over the bad memo file.
>
>Are there any utility programs that will recover at least part of the data in the Memo field???
